From mboxrd@z Thu Jan 1 00:00:00 1970 From: York Sun Date: Tue, 13 Aug 2013 13:32:03 -0700 Subject: [U-Boot] [U-Boot, v1, 5/8] fsl: do not define FSL_SRIO_PCIE_BOOT_MASTER for all P2041 systems In-Reply-To: <1374832955-4544-6-git-send-email-valentin.longchamp@keymile.com> References: <1374832955-4544-6-git-send-email-valentin.longchamp@keymile.com> Message-ID: <520A97C3.4030806@freescale.com> List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: u-boot@lists.denx.de On 07/26/2013 03:02 AM, Valentin Longchamp wrote: > If this #define stays in config_mpc85xx.h, the P2041 based boards must > define a lot of SRIO values even if they do not implement a SRIO device. > > The #define is moved into the P2041RDB board config file where it is > used. > > Signed-off-by: Valentin Longchamp > > --- > include/configs/P2041RDB.h | 1 + > 1 file changed, 1 insertion(+) > > diff --git a/include/configs/P2041RDB.h b/include/configs/P2041RDB.h > index 4ea8717..523117b 100644 > --- a/include/configs/P2041RDB.h > +++ b/include/configs/P2041RDB.h > @@ -399,6 +399,7 @@ unsigned long get_board_sys_clk(unsigned long dummy); > * for slave u-boot IMAGE instored in master memory space, > * PHYS must be aligned based on the SIZE > */ > +#define CONFIG_SYS_FSL_SRIO_PCIE_BOOT_MASTER > #define CONFIG_SRIO_PCIE_BOOT_IMAGE_MEM_PHYS 0xfef080000ull > #define CONFIG_SRIO_PCIE_BOOT_IMAGE_MEM_BUS1 0xfff80000ull > #define CONFIG_SRIO_PCIE_BOOT_IMAGE_SIZE 0x80000 /* 512K */ I failed to see what problem this patch fixes. Maybe you were using an older copy of u-boot? York